Following his 11-length victory over General Wolfe - with Eudipe back in fourth and Go Ballistic pulled up - in the Edward Hanmer Memorial Limited Handicap Chase over 3m at Haydock last Wednesday Suny Bay, who gets just a 4lb penalty for that, is a top-priced 4-1 favourite with William Hill - Coral go just 3-1.

Barton Bank, runner up to One Man at Wetherby last time, is 14-1 with the Tote - Ladbrokes go 9-1 - while the progressive Indian Tracker is 25-1 with Ladbrokes - the Tote go just 14-1.

In today's 3.40 at Huntingdon, Prizefighter is 25-1 with the Tote - William Hill go 16-1.
